Player Overview

Jerry Stroope is an American professional poker player who has been active in live cash games and tournaments for a long time. He has gained a certain level of recognition in the poker community through his consistent performance and history of competing against many well-known players.

Career and Major Achievements

Jerry Stroope's career covers a variety of major events, including the World Series of Poker (WSOP). He has cashed in multiple tournaments, though specific placements and prize amounts are not detailed in public sources. His performance in high-stakes cash games is more notable, often playing at the same tables as top players like Tom Dwan.
